In order to support easy RBAC integration for CustomResources and Extension
APIServers, we need to have a way for API extenders to add permissions to the
"normal" roles for admin, edit, and view.

aggregate cluster roles

xref kubernetes/community#1219 kubernetes/enhancements#502

This is a pull with API types, a controller, and a demonstration of how to move admin, edit, and view.  Once we agree on the shape, I'll 


I added 
```yaml
aggregationRule:
  clusterRoleSelectors:
  - matchLabels:
      rbac.authorization.k8s.io/aggregate-to-admin: true
```
to the `ClusterRole`.  A controller then goes and gathers all the matching ClusterRoles and sets the `rules` to the union of matching cluster roles.
